Q: How is the Low Relaxation Prestressed Concrete Strand used in construction?
A: The strand is typically embedded in concrete and tensioned before or after pouring. It minimizes relaxation over time, ensuring structures like bridges and buildings maintain strength and stability.

Q: What process is involved in the production of these strands?
A: The strand is made by twisting high-strength steel wires, followed by a precise heating process to reduce relaxation. A black protective finish is applied for additional resilience.
